What Are Remanufactured Japanese Engines?

Remanufactured Japanese engines are engines that have been completely disassembled, cleaned, inspected, and rebuilt to meet or exceed original manufacturer specifications. Unlike used or simply rebuilt engines, remanufactured engines undergo a highly controlled process where worn-out components are replaced with new or refurbished parts.

This process ensures that the engine performs like new while maintaining the original engineering excellence of Japanese automotive brands. According to industry insights, remanufactured engines are rigorously tested and often deliver performance comparable to new engines, making them a dependable option for vehicle replacement needs.

Why Japanese Engines Are Highly Preferred

Japanese engines are globally recognized for their precision engineering, reliability, and efficiency. Brands like Toyota, Honda, and Nissan have built a reputation for producing engines that last longer and perform better.

One key reason behind this reliability is Japan’s strict vehicle inspection system, which ensures that vehicles are well-maintained throughout their lifecycle. As a result, engines sourced from Japan often come from low-mileage vehicles and are in excellent condition.

Additionally, Japanese engines are manufactured with high-quality materials and advanced technologies, contributing to superior durability and fuel efficiency.

The Remanufacturing Process Explained

Understanding the remanufacturing process helps highlight why these engines are so reliable. The process typically involves:

1. Complete Disassembly

The engine is taken apart entirely to inspect each component individually.

2. Cleaning and Inspection

All parts are cleaned and evaluated for wear, damage, or defects.

3. Replacement of Worn Components

Critical components such as pistons, bearings, seals, and gaskets are replaced with new ones.

4. Precision Machining

Engine blocks and crankshafts are machined to restore original specifications.

5. Reassembly and Testing

The engine is reassembled and tested under load conditions to ensure optimal performance.

This detailed process ensures consistency, reliability, and long-term functionality.

Remanufactured vs Used vs Rebuilt Engines

It’s important to understand how remanufactured engines differ from other options:

Used Engines

  • Taken directly from another vehicle

  • May have unknown wear and tear

  • Lower cost but higher risk

Rebuilt Engines

  • Partially repaired or refurbished

  • Some components may remain old

  • Quality depends on the rebuilder

Remanufactured Engines

  • Completely restored to OEM standards

  • Thoroughly tested and verified

  • Offer the best balance of cost and reliability

Remanufactured engines stand out as the most dependable option among the three.
